Lecture 23: from air pollution to global warming. Themes: interdependence of human systems (industrialisation, urbanisation, energy use) and physical systems (air pollution, greenhouse efect) climate change. An example of human geography"s environment- society tradition: scale efects: with globalization, outcomes that were localized and minor become international, even global, and serious in their consequences. Chernobyl: a local industrial accident in a nuclear reactor in ukraine in 1986 became a global polluter as radio-active clouds circles the world twice. Historic air pollution in london: london"s fog is so thick one might have spread it on bread , london"s fogs converted the human larynx into an ill-swept chimney . London"s 4 day pea souper smog of 1952: 12000 fatalities: this was resolved with two developments. The second was a change in the heating of homes. Because of the coal they used to warm their houses. Beijing smog, 2013: 7 million die globally each year from air pollution.
